Men’s Basketball Comes Up Short Versus UMFK

Waterville, ME – Men's Basketball came up short against the University of Maine Fort Kent Bengals in a back-and-forth battle 72-75 on Sunday, January 7th, 2024. 
 
Thomas College: Overall (5-8), NAC (2-1)
University of Maine Fort Kent: Overall (4-4), USCAA (1-2)
 
How it Happened:
  • This game once again started as a back-and-forth contest, with both teams trading points until it was 10-10 five minutes in.
  • A layup by Metin Yavuz and three-pointer by Jackson Ruelke shortly after gave the Terriers a five-point lead.
  • The Bengals were able to rally back, trading points with the Terriers until they took back the lead with five minutes left in the first half.
  • Cooper Wirkala would go on to score seven points with four minutes left in the first half, helping the Terriers to a 33-30 halftime lead.
  • The Bengals started the second half well, going on a 10-0 run in three minutes of action to give them a 40-33 lead.
  • The Terriers were quick to respond with six points, but the Bengals kept their consistency.
  • With 12 minutes remaining in the game, the Terriers went on an 8-2 run to take the lead yet again, 51-50.
  • The Bengals quickly took back the lead, but the Terriers wouldn't give up easily.
  • Both teams battled it out until the final few minutes, when the Terriers went on an 8-0 run thanks to some clutch free throws from James Phelan and a three-pointer from Parker Desjardins.
  • This cut the Bengal lead to just one with 20 seconds left on the clock, but the Bengals sank both of their remaining free throws and came up with a huge steal to get the win.
  • The final score was a 72-75 loss for the Terriers, coming up just short in this back-and-forth contest.
Inside the Stats:
  • The Terriers dominated in points off of turnovers with 15, compared to the four produced by the Bengals. 
  • Wirkala would lead all Terrier scorers with 15 points, while adding three rebounds.
  • Troy Tinch scored 12 points in 15 minutes, going 6/10 from the field.
